Description[?]:
The state should cement it’s position on adultery, to be clear and concise. Outright allowing adultery isn’t a good idea, because it creates strife and causes issues, and divorces are bad for children. Instead, the policy on adultery should follow these lines: it is illegal, but not prosecuted. For all intents and purposes, it should be stated as illegal. This is to discourage such actions, without impeding on the rights of the citizenry. |
